Title: New trigger for me please help
Post by bm7680 on Jul 25th, 2015 at 4:33pm
I was so happy because I finally made three days and nights in a row pain free and no CH attacks. I really thought my cycle was over. I woke up today feeling great so I sat outside by the pool. Although I was in the sun I wasn't too hot and was drinking iced tea. About a half hour into it I got hit with one of worst CHs yet. No warning. Thank God I was home. I immediately had to go inside. It's been hours and I'm still in pain. I can not even see out of my left eye. I now fear tonight. Does anyone know what could have set the beast off by being outside???

Title: Re: New trigger for me please help
Post by Ricardo on Aug 3rd, 2015 at 9:02am
Something I have found kinda strange with me is that just about any amount of green or black (especially black) tea is pretty much guaranteed to trigger my clusters.  A few other leafy green herbals do the same (most of them seem to have a high tannin content).  I've been avoiding any amount of the Camellia sinensis plant for almost 10 years now.  May or may not relate to your situation. 

-Ricardo
